Epilepsy surgery in children and adolescents

Summary
Pediatric epilepsy surgery offers high success rates for intractable cases. Temporal lobectomy and hemispherectomy show promising outcomes, improving seizure control in young patients.

Background:
- Increasing interest in surgical interventions for pediatric epilepsy.
- Advances in diagnostic methods and understanding of epilepsy's natural history drive surgical consideration.
- Surgical management is increasingly explored for intractable childhood epilepsy.
Purpose of the Study:
- To report surgical outcomes in pediatric patients with intractable epilepsy.
- To evaluate the efficacy of different surgical procedures for seizure control.
- To assess success rates based on specific surgical techniques.
Main Methods:
- Retrospective analysis of 76 pediatric patients (≤19 years) undergoing epilepsy surgery.
- Categorization of surgical procedures including temporal lobectomy, extratemporal resections, hemispherectomy, and corpus callosotomy.
- Success defined as Engel Grades I and II (no seizures with loss of consciousness).
Main Results:
- Overall success rate of 78% for 52 patients undergoing temporal lobectomy.
- Hemispherectomy achieved an 80% success rate in 10 children.
- Extratemporal resections showed a 75% success rate, while corpus callosotomy had a 33% success rate.
Conclusions:
- Epilepsy surgery, particularly temporal lobectomy and hemispherectomy, is highly effective for managing intractable pediatric epilepsy.
- Different surgical approaches yield varying success rates, highlighting the importance of tailored treatment strategies.
- Surgical intervention offers a viable option for seizure freedom in a significant proportion of children with refractory epilepsy.
